iPod Classic Troubleshooting - iFixit

WebDec 2, 2024 · Plug your iPod in to charge for at least four hours. Make sure you use an official Apple cable and adapter with it. Don’t charge your iPod from a computer port, as it may not provide enough power. Connect it to a wall outlet with a power adapter instead. Computer USB ports don’t provide as much power as regular outlets. WebConnect your iPod touch to your computer and launch Joyoshare UltFix. Let the scan be completed, then click “Transfer Data” to start. northampton oil changeWebJul 3, 2024 · Restart your computer, as well as your iPod, iPad, or iPhone. Update all the software on your devices: iOS, macOS, Windows, and iTunes. Try a different cable and different USB ports, also try a different computer.
